This print captures a pivotal moment in history as Norman cavalry clashes with Harold's foot soldiers, forming an impenetrable shield wall. Taken from the renowned Bayeux Tapestry, located in Bayeux, Normandy, France, this past embroidered tapestry depicts the intense warfare of the Norman invasion. The intricate embroidery and vibrant colors bring to life the chaos and bravery of these ancient battles. The image showcases the skillful artistry of this historical masterpiece while providing a glimpse into the tactics employed during medieval warfare. The use of bows and arrows by both sides adds another layer of intensity to this already gripping scene.
